                  4. Adjustment Upon Changes in Capitalization. In order to
prevent dilution of the rights granted under this Option, the option price and
the number of shares purchasable hereunder shall be subject to adjustment from
time to time as follows:

                  (a) Adjustment of Number of Shares of Common Stock Upon
Issuance of Common Stock or Common Stock Equivalents. If and whenever the
Company issues or sells, or in accordance with paragraph (b) is deemed to have
issued or sold, any Common Stock for a consideration per share less than the
Fair Market Value per share at the time of such issue or sale (not including the
issuance of the Permitted Stock (as defined below)) then forthwith upon such
issue or sale, the shares of Common Stock subject to this

<PAGE>   3


Option (the "Subject Shares") will be increased by multiplying such number by a
fraction, (A) the numerator of which is the Fair Market Value per share at the
time of such issue or sale and (B) the denominator of which is the amount
determined by dividing (a) the sum of (1) the produce derived by multiplying the
Fair Market Value per share at the time of such issue or sale times the number
of shares of Common Stock outstanding on a Fully-Diluted Basis immediately prior
to such issue or sale, plus (2) the aggregate consideration, if any, received by
the Company upon such issue or sale, by (b) the number of shares of Common Stock
outstanding on a Fully-Diluted Basis immediately after such issue or sale.

                  (b) Effect on Subject Shares of Certain Events. For purposes
of determining the adjusted Subject Shares under paragraph (a) above, the
following will be applicable:

                           (i) Issuance of Common Stock Equivalents. If the
Company in any manner grants any Common Stock Equivalent (as defined below)
(other than Permitted Stock) and the lowest price per share for which any one
share of Common Stock of the Company is issuable upon the exercise of any such
Common Stock Equivalent is less than the Fair Market Value of the Common Stock
at the time of the granting of such Common Stock Equivalent, then all of such
shares of Common Stock will be deemed to have been issued and sold by the
Company for such price per share (other than pursuant to antidilutive
adjustments to the Options). For purposes of this paragraph, the "lowest price
per share for which any one share is issuable" will be equal to the sum of the
lowest amounts of consideration (if any) received or receivable by the Company
with respect to any one share upon the exercise of the Common Stock Equivalent
(whether by conversion, exchange or otherwise) or other similar indication of
the price per share as of the time of granting (such as the floor value for
stock appreciation rights). No further adjustment of the Subject Shares will be
made upon the actual issue of such shares of Common Stock or upon the exercise
of any right under the Common Stock Equivalents.

                           (ii) Change in Option Price or Conversion Rate. If
the purchase price provided for in any Common Stock Equivalent (other than
Permitted Stock), the additional consideration, if any, payable upon the issue,
conversion or exchange of any Common Stock Equivalent, or the rate at which any
Common Stock Equivalent is convertible into or exchangeable for shares of Common
Stock changes at any time, the Subject Shares in effect at the time of such
change will be readjusted to the Subject Shares which would have been in effect
t such time had such Common Stock Equivalent still outstanding provided for such
changed purchase price, additional consideration or changed conversion rate, as
the case may be, at the time initially granted, issued or sold.

                           (iii) Treatment of Expired and Unexercised Common
Stock Equivalents. Upon the expiration of any Common Stock Equivalent or the
termination of any right to convert or exchange any Common Stock Equivalent
without the exercise of such Common Stock Equivalent, the Subject Shares then in
effect will be adjusted to the Subject Shares which would have been in effect at
the time of such expiration or termination had such Common Stock Equivalent, to
the extent outstanding immediately prior to such expiration or termination,
never been issued.

                           (iv) Calculation of Consideration Received. If any
Common Stock or Common Stock Equivalents (other than Permitted Stock) are issued
or sold or deemed to have been issued or sold for cash, the consideration
received therefor will be deemed to be the net amount received by the Company.
In case any Common Stock or Common Stock Equivalents (other than Permitted
Stock) are issued or sold for a consideration other than cash, the amount of the
consideration other than cash received by the Company will be the fair market
value of such consideration. In case any Common Stock or Common Stock
Equivalents (other than Permitted Stock) are issued to the owners of the
non-surviving entity in connection

<PAGE>   4


with any merger in which the Company is the surviving entity, the amount of
consideration therefor will be deemed to be the fair market value of such
portion of the net assets and business of the non-surviving entity as is
attributable top such Common Stock or Common Stock Equivalents, as the case may
be.

                           (v) Integrated Transactions. In case any Common Stock
Equivalent (other than Permitted Stock) is issued in connection with the issue
or sale of other securities of the Company, together comprising one integrated
transaction in which no specific consideration is allocated to such Common Stock
Equivalent by the parties thereto, the Common Stock Equivalent will be deemed to
have been issued without consideration.

                           (vi) Record Date. If the Company takes a record of
the holders of Common Stock for the purpose of entitling them (A) to receive a
dividend or other distribution payable in Common Stock or Common Stock
Equivalents or (B) to subscribe for or purchase Common Stock or Common Stock
Equivalents, then such record date will be deemed to be the date of the issue or
sale of the Common Stock deemed to have been issued or sold upon the declaration
of such dividend or the making of such other distribution or the date of the
granting of such right of subscription or purchase, as the case may be.

                  (c) Subdivision or Combination of Common Stock. If the Company
at any time subdivides (by any stock split, stock dividend, recapitalization or
otherwise) one or more classes of its outstanding Common Stock into a greater
number of shares of Common Stock, the Subject Shares in effect immediately prior
to such subdivision will be proportionately increased. If the Company at any
time combines (by reverse stock split or otherwise) one or more classes of its
outstanding shares of Common Stock, the Subject Shares in effect immediately
prior to such combination will be proportionately decreased.

                  (h) Certain Definitions. As used in this Section 4, the
following terms shall have the meanings ascribed to them:

                           (i) "Common Stock Equivalent" means any option,
warrant, right or similar security exercisable into, exchangeable for, or
convertible to Common Stock or the economic equivalent value of Common Stock,
other than any Permitted Stock.


<PAGE>   6


                           (ii) "Control Basis" means the valuation of
securities by determining on any aggregate basis the fair market value of all
securities of such type on the basis of the securities being sold in the
aggregate to a third party buyer in an arm's length transaction with conveyance
of control, without discount for minority interests, illiquidity or restrictions
on transfer, and then dividing such amount by the number of all securities of
such type on a Fully-Diluted Basis.

                           (iii) "Fair Market Value" means (a) as to securities
regularly traded in the organized securities markets, the average of the Closing
Price for the security in question for the thirty (30) trading days immediately
preceding the date of determination; and (b) as to all securities not regularly
traded in the securities markets and other property, the fair market value of
such securities, on a Control Basis, or property as of the date of the delivery
of a notice from a Optionee necessitating the determination of fair market value
(unless some other date of valuation is provided herein) as determined in good
faith by the Board (provided that any such determination by the Board shall be
subject to the same rights of dispute and resolution on the part of the Optionee
as set forth in Section 1(b) hereof). Notwithstanding the foregoing, the Fair
Market Value of any shares of Common Stock shall be as determined in accordance
with Section 1(b).

                           (iv) "Fully-Diluted Basis" when used means including
as outstanding all Common Stock and Common Stock Equivalents including, without
limitation, the Common Stock issuable upon exercise of Options.

                           (v) "Permitted Stock" shall include all shares of
Common Stock or Common Stock Equivalents issued or issuable on or prior to the
date of this Option.
